[Flashlight On/Off] ──> [Morse Code] ──> [Binary (0 and 1)] ──> [Logic Gates] ──> [CPU Architecture] The narrative builds sequentially:
Beyond these, the entire book has been revised, with updated cultural and technology references, modernized explanations, and improved two-color line drawings to make the concepts even clearer.
is the extensively updated version of Charles Petzold’s 1999 masterpiece that demystifies how computers function from the ground up. Rather than starting with complex programming languages, Petzold begins with familiar concepts like Morse code and telegraph relays to show how simple "on-off" switches eventually evolve into modern microprocessors. What’s New in the 2nd Edition?
The second edition preserves the accessible, whimsical charm of the original while injecting the necessary updates to reflect modern computing power. It remains an essential read for anyone who wants to truly speak the hidden language of the machines that rule our world. [Flashlight On/Off] ──> [Morse Code] ──> [Binary (0
If you are interested in ordering this book, Amazon.in typically offers new copies of the Second Edition. Share public link
from the companion website
A computer needs to store its results to function effectively. Code introduces the flip-flop circuit, a mechanism created by feedback loops in logic gates. What’s New in the 2nd Edition
If you're interested in reading "Code: The Hidden Language of Computer Hardware and Software, 2nd Edition," you can find a PDF version online. Please note that downloading copyrighted materials may be subject to certain restrictions and regulations. Make sure to verify the source and comply with any applicable laws.
This masterpiece is not just a book; it is a journey that demystifies the digital world. The 2nd edition, published by Microsoft Press in 2022, updates a classic, ensuring that its lessons remain relevant in the modern age of computing. Whether you are a beginner looking to understand the fundamentals or a seasoned professional wanting to grasp the hardware-software connection, this book is an essential read. What Makes 'Code' (2nd Edition) Essential?
Code: The Hidden Language of Computer Hardware and Software (2nd Edition) is arguably the best book for demystifying computers. It turns the magic of technology into the science of ingenuity. If you are interested in ordering this book, Amazon
: Explaining how patterns of raised bumps create an organized data representation language.
Petzold has added new content that dives deeper into how modern computing works, particularly concerning control signals, advanced logic, and CPU architecture.
The 2nd edition is roughly 70 pages longer than the original and includes several significant enhancements: Code: The Hidden Language of Computer Hardware and Software
A dedicated website, CodeHiddenLanguage.com, accompanies the book, providing animations of key circuits that make understanding computer logic easier than ever. Key Themes and Concepts
It serves as the perfect, conversational companion textbook for introductory Computer Science or Computer Engineering courses. Final Thoughts